The usual source for libssl.a and libcrypto.a for DJGPP is the openssl
distribution. See http://www.openssl.org. The latest version of the
0.9.7 series should configure and compile with DJGPP under a bash
shell. See the file in the distribution called "INSTALL.DJGPP". You
will need the watt-32 library on your system before trying to compile
openssl. I am unfamiliar with packages named "libssl09-dev" and
"libCrypto"? Where did you get these package names? Are you sure that
this is something that has been ported to DJGPP?

I haven't checked to see if my latest patch for openssl has been
committed to the CVS code. If you have trouble compiling under DJGPP,
see my patch in the openssl-dev mailing list for 19 November 2002,
entitled "DJGPP patch for openssl-0.9.7".

Note that the use of the watt-32 library implies a DOS based approach
to sockets. You will not be able to use Winsock with programs compiled
with watt-32 unless you also use the ndis3pkt program.
